13 / 36 page ![]() © 2009 Microchip Technology Inc. DS21950E-page 13 MCP3550/1/3 3.0 PIN DESCRIPTIONS The descriptions of the pins are listed in Table 3-1. TABLE 3-1: PIN FUNCTION TABLE 3.1 Voltage Reference (VREF) The MCP3550/1/3 devices accept single-ended reference voltages from 0.1V to VDD. Since the converter output noise is dominated by thermal noise, which is independent of the reference voltage, the output noise is not significantly improved by diminishing the reference voltage at the VREF input pin. A reduced voltage reference will significantly improve the INL performance (see Figure 2-4); the INL max error is proportional to VREF2. 3.2 Analog Inputs (VIN+, VIN-) The MCP3550/1/3 devices accept a fully differential analog input voltage to be connected on the VIN+ and VIN- input pins. The differential voltage that is converted is defined by VIN = VIN+ – VIN-. The differential voltage range specified for ensured accuracy is from -VREF to +VREF. However, the converter will still output valid and usable codes with the inputs overranged by up to 12% (see Section 5.0 “Serial Interface”) at room temperature. This overrange is clearly specified by two overload bits in the output code. The absolute voltage range on these input pins extends from VSS – 0.3V to VDD + 0.3V. Any voltage above or below this range will create leakage currents through the Electrostatic Discharge (ESD) diodes. This current will increase exponentially, degrading the accuracy and noise performance of the device. The common mode of the analog inputs should be chosen such that both the differential analog input range and the absolute voltage range on each pin are within the specified operating range defined in Section 1.0 “Electrical Characteristics”. 3.3 Supply Voltage (VDD, VSS) VDD is the power supply pin for the analog and digital circuitry within the MCP3550/1/3. This pin requires an appropriate bypass capacitor of 0.1 µF. The voltage on this pin should be maintained in the 2.7V to 5.5V range for specified operation. VSS is the ground pin and the current return path for both analog and digital circuitry of the MCP3550/1/3. If an analog ground plane is available, it is recommended that this device be tied to the analog ground plane of the Printed Circuit Board (PCB). 3.4 Serial Clock (SCK) SCK synchronizes data communication with the device. The device operates in both SPI mode 1,1 and SPI mode 0,0. Data is shifted out of the device on the falling edge of SCK. Data is latched in on the rising edge of SCK. During CS high times, the SCK pin can idle either high or low. 3.5 Data Output (SDO/RDY) SDO/RDY is the output data pin for the device. Once a conversion is complete, this pin will go active-low, acting as a ready flag. Subsequent falling clock edges will then place the 24-bit data word (two overflow bits and 22 bits of data, see Section 5.0 “Serial Interface”) on the SPI bus through the SDO pin. Data is clocked out on the falling edge of SCK.
